Mervyn vows to tackle assailants himself
* Malaka in ICU following attack
Public Relations Affairs Minister Mervyn Silva’s son, Malaka, has been
hospitalized with serious injuries, after being attacked with a sharp
instrument, at the Odel clothing store car park, in Town Hall, around
4.15 p.m. yesterday.
He had been admitted to the Nawaloka Hospital, Police spokesman SP Buddhika Siriwardena said.
Minister Silva told Hiru TV yesterday that he had no need for the police
and he himself would deal with the assailants if they dared come
forward.
Malaka was transferred to the Intensive Care Unit. He had been attacked
by about ten persons at the cark park of the clothing store, SP
Siriwardena said, adding that the suspects had arrived there in a
Defender and had waited for Malaka to return from the shop with his
girlfriend. They had tried to abduct him following a heated argument.
They had first attacked Malaka in his head and face using bottles of
water and shoes.
Preliminary investigations have revealed that the attackers had used a
vehicle with false number plate to give the impression that it was a
vehicle belonging to VIP security division.
One of the attackers had grabbed the bottle of water from a security guard at the Car Park and attacked Malaka with it.
The attackers spared girlfriend and fled.
SP Siriwardena said that entire episode had been recorded in the CCTV
network fixed at the car park and the attackers would soon be
identified.
Colombo Crimes Division and Cinnamon Gardens police are conducting further investigations.
VAAS GUNAWARDENE’S SON BARRED FROM LEAVING COUNTRY
The
Colombo Magistrate’s Court today ordered the Immigration Controller to
prevent former DIG Vaas Gunawardene’s son Ravindu Gunawardene from
leaving the country.
The order was issued by Colombo Additional Magistrate M.A. Sahabdeen after considering a request made by the Criminal Investigations Department (CID).
ASP Shani Abeysekara of the CID informed court that investigations are underway to arrest Ravindu, who along with his father are suspects in the murder of businessman Mohamed Siyam, and that the Kaduwala Magistrate has also issued a warrant for his arrest.
Therefore the CID requested a court order preventing him from leaving the country.
Seven suspects including former DIG Vaas Gunawardene area currently in remand custody until August 01 over the abduction and murder of the Bambalapitiya-based businessman.
